Transaction 255099266aa1a9da8c5e727a2753033d720c1831c3bddc0d439a246ecfe93190
1 Input
1 Output
-
255099266aa1a9da8c5e727a2753033d720c1831c3bddc0d439a246ecfe93190:0
- value
- 6711320
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dbb877ab1d91db315d33dad4af30b1a01ae838ce OP_EQUAL
- address
- 3MintaUt7dQYricNAXXjVzVZ95H4erH38y